Login
Start Free Trial Are you a business? Click Here
Fiona Cahoon
I was over charged for my purchase. It says £25 on the price tag but was charged £30. Was not offered refund so will be taken it further
6 years ago
Read USC Reviews
USC has a 3.6 average rating from 37,501 reviews